Eurillas virens

The little greenbul (Eurillas virens ) is a species of the bulbul family of passerine birds. It is found in many parts of sub-Saharan Africa.

Appearance

The little greenbul is a small bird reaching a total length of about 187 mm, with wings of about 80 mm and tail of about 77 mm. The upper tail and wings are brown, while breast and flanks are pale grey-greenish (hence the Latin name virens of this species, meaning "green"). The bill is brown, the iris is brown and the feet are light yellow-brown.
